The order of the planets from the sun, starting closest and moving outwards: Mercury, venus, earth, mars, jupiter, saturn, uranus, and neptune. The solar system has eight planets: Mercury, venus, earth, mars, jupiter, saturn, uranus, neptune. The largest planet in the solar system is jupiter, followed by saturn, uranus, neptune, earth, venus, mars with the smallest being mercury.
